调试程序错误出现这样的错误,求助高手

调试程序错误出现这样的错误,求助高手,第1张

关于源程序错误调试问题,如果说是编译错误发生在自己编写源程序的过程中的话,那么问题的原因还是比较复杂的。因为编译错误有很多种。例如:语法错误、系统库连接错误、语义错误、数组越界、或者内存越界等等。

通常源程序的语法错误是最好解决的,因为源程序的语法出错了,连编译这一关都通不过,并且会告诉你在哪一行出错笑厅拆了,这种错误是最容易调试的。最难调试的情况就是:源碰枣程序虽然编译、链接都通过了,但是程序的运行伏运结果却是错误的。

所以说,你必须要把详细的出错信息写出来,别人们才好帮助你进行具体的分析。

编译错误、运行错误、逻辑错误

明显不符合语法的,比如单词写错的,符号写错的,编译的时候就会出错,无法生产EXE文件。

运行错误,比如运行时候打开的文扰做亩件不存在,或者没有某些权限,或者网络无法连接,造成运行胡槐时候报告错误,程序退出。

逻辑错误是语句写错,或者思路不正确,造成运行时候死循环,或者缓森不是预期的结果。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12561838.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-26
下一篇 2023-05-26

发表评论

登录后才能评论

评论列表(0条)

保存